Abstract:
Kelakai (S. palustris) is an epiphytic plant that lives in Riau, specially swampy area.
This study aim was to evaluate antioxidant activity from different extracts of S.
palustris. The extraction method was done by using macerationin methanol followed by
partitioned with n-hexane, dichloromethane (DCM), and ethyl acetate.The extracts were
tested for antioxidant activity by using the 1,1-diphenyl-2-picrylhydrazyl (DPPH)
method. The Antioxidant Activity Index (AAI) of extracts showed various activities
where DCM extract depicted high activity.
